That's funny, I look at that same schedule and think," oh no, we're not battle tested enough. Where's Pitt, where's G'town, where's Cuse, where's Villanova ... "

Final Fours 2009 - 2013:

Colonial - 1
Missouri Valley - 1
Big 12 - 1
Horizon - 2
ACC - 2
SEC - 2
B1G - 4
Big East - 7

It was that tough conference schedule that helped get 7 Big East teams into the Final Four the past 5 years.
